Does NULOJIX Cause Renal failure acute? 5 Reports in FDA Database

According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 5 reports of Renal failure acute have been filed in association with NULOJIX. This represents 15.2% of all adverse event reports for NULOJIX.

How Dangerous Is Renal failure acute From NULOJIX?
Of the 5 reports, 1 (20.0%) resulted in death, 4 (80.0%) required hospitalization, and 1 (20.0%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Renal failure acute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for NULOJIX. However, 5 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
